site stats

Join df on index

NettetEfficiently join multiple DataFrame objects by index at once by passing a list. Column or index level name (s) in the caller to join on the index in right, otherwise joins index-on-index. If multiple values given, the right DataFrame must have a MultiIndex. Can pass an array as the join key if it is not already contained in the calling DataFrame. Nettet3. mar. 2024 · df_combined = df_orders.merge(df_unique_customers, how=’left’, on=”CUSTOMERNAME”) Time for 10000 joins 16.125476121902466 average time per join 0.0016125476121902466. By simply setting the index to the column we plan to join on(can be done using set_index(“CUSTOMERNAME”)), we see an immediate speed …

Pandas Merge on Index : How to merge two dataframes in Python

Nettetright_index bool, default False. Use the index from the right DataFrame as the join key. Same caveats as left_index. sort bool, default False. Sort the join keys lexicographically in the result DataFrame. If False, the order of the join keys depends on the join type (how keyword). suffixes list-like, default is (“_x”, “_y”) NettetDataFrame.join(other: pyspark.sql.dataframe.DataFrame, on: Union [str, List [str], pyspark.sql.column.Column, List [pyspark.sql.column.Column], None] = None, how: … cibc water street st john\\u0027s nl https://snapdragonphotography.net

Understand Polars’ Lack of Indexes by Carl M. Kadie Towards …

Nettet25. apr. 2024 · pandas merge(): Combining Data on Common Columns or Indices. The first technique that you’ll learn is merge().You can use merge() anytime you want functionality similar to a database’s join … Nettetmerge is a function in the pandas namespace, and it is also available as a DataFrame instance method merge (), with the calling DataFrame being implicitly considered the … Nettet9. mai 2024 · Right Join. It gives the data which are matching all the rows in the second data frame with the corresponding values on the first data frame. For this merge () function should be provided with dataframes along with all parameters assigned TRUE. all parameters should have a reference to the right dataframe. dghrd sparrow seva

Pandas Join vs. Merge. What Do They Do And When Should We …

Category:Combining Data in Pandas. Using append, concat, join and …

Tags:Join df on index

Join df on index

python - How to do join of multiindex dataframe with a single …

NettetIf we want to join using the key columns, we need to set key to be the index in both df and right. The joined DataFrame will have key as its index. >>> join_psdf = psdf1 . … NettetIn this tutorial you’ll learn how to join two DataFrames based on index values in the Python programming language. Example Data. import pandas as pd # Load pandas df1 …

Join df on index

Did you know?

Nettet14. nov. 2024 · Hello, im trying merging or joining 2 dataframe on the same index. i have just checked this page Joins · DataFrames.jl and it seems all the join require the name of a column, but id like to use the index instead of column. if it was possible to use something like: join (df,df, on: index/row) edit: merge!() seems to be perfect but its deprecated…

NettetHere’s an example code to convert a CSV file to an Excel file using Python: # Read the CSV file into a Pandas DataFrame df = pd.read_csv ('input_file.csv') # Write the DataFrame to an Excel file df.to_excel ('output_file.xlsx', index=False) Python. In the above code, we first import the Pandas library. Then, we read the CSV file into a … NettetOptional. Specifies in what level to do the merging on the DataFrame to the right: left_index: True False: Optional. Default False. Whether to use the index from the left DataFrame as join key or not: right_index: True False: Optional. Default False. Whether to use the index from the right DataFrame as join key or not: sort: True False: Optional.

Nettet17. apr. 2024 · merge vs join. Joining by index (using df.join) is much faster than joins on arbtitrary columns!. The difference between dataframe.merge() and dataframe.join() is that with dataframe.merge() you can join on any columns, whereas dataframe.join() only lets you join on index columns.. pd.merge() vs dataframe.join() vs dataframe.merge() … Nettet6. jan. 2024 · That will give us insight into the practicality of working without indexes. In the end, we’ll see that: “Indexes are not needed! Not having them makes things easier.”. If you think you really need an index, you really need a dictionary. To reach that end, let’s start by creating a dataframe and retrieving a simple row.

Nettet5. apr. 2024 · df = pd.merge(df1, df2, on="ID", ... Output : Merged Dataframe. Merging two Dataframes with the ID column, with all the ID’s of the right Dataframe i.e. second parameter of the merge function. The ID’s which do not match from df1 gets a ... How to Merge Two Pandas DataFrames on Index. 7. How to Merge DataFrames of different ...

Nettet4. jul. 2024 · DataFrame 数据合并(merge,join,concat) 文章目录DataFrame 数据合并(merge,join,concat)merge特性示例(1)特性示例(2)特性示例(3)特性示例(4)join示例concat示例(1)示例(2)示例(3)append汇总 merge merge 函数通过一个或多个键将数据集的行连接起来。场景:针对同一个主键存在的两张包含不同特征的表,通... cibc waterloo qcNettetRepeat over until you're happy with the performance. Columns used in WHERE or ORDER BY clauses are the prime candidates for those indices - but don't over-index! That's … dghrd irs hopNettetEXAMPLE 1: Using the Pandas Merge Method. In pandas, there is a function pandas.merge () that allows you to merge two dataframes on the index. Execute the following code to merge both dataframes df1 and df2. pd.merge (df1, df2, left_index= True, right_index= True) Here I am passing four parameters. The first and second … dgh realty yuma azNettetJoining on index. Sometimes you may have to perform the join on the indexes or the row labels. To do so, you have to specify right_index (for the indexes of the right … dghrd vehicle policyNettetright_index bool, default False. Use the index from the right DataFrame as the join key. Same caveats as left_index. sort bool, default False. Sort the join keys … dgh realtyNettet11. apr. 2016 · You can do this with merge:. df_merged = df1.merge(df2, how='outer', left_index=True, right_index=True) The keyword argument how='outer' keeps all indices from both frames, filling in missing indices with NaN.The left_index and right_index keyword arguments have the merge be done on the indices. If you get all NaN in a … cibc water street st. john\u0027s nlNettet20. mai 2014 · I used the other option that you mentioned: not setting the 'on' param and let them join on index automatically, which is working! BTW, to set the index for a … cibc weather